openfang: 這是什麼、解決了什麼問題以及為什麼它正受到關注

openfang: 這是什麼、解決了什麼問題以及為什麼它正受到關注

解決了什麼問題

OpenFang 是一個自主代理作業系統,旨在超越簡單的聊天機器人。它使代理能夠根據排程(24/7)獨立工作,執行複雜的任務,例如市場研究、潛在客戶開發和社群媒體管理,而無需使用者持續不斷地提示。

如何運作

為了實現高性能和安全性,OpenFang 使用 Rust 編寫,並編譯成單一二進位檔。它使用模組化核心架構來管理編排、記憶體(SQLite 和 vector)以及工具執行。該系統引入了「Hands」——預建的自主能力套件,這些套件結合了清單(HAND.toml)、專家系統提示詞和特定領域知識(SKILL.md)來獨立執行多階段工作流。

對象是誰

它是為需要可靠、自主的 AI 代理,且這些代理能夠在背景運作、與大量通訊管道整合,並為生產級自動化維持高安全性態勢的使用者和開發者而設計的。

重點摘要

  • 自主 Hands: 包括 7 個內建代理,用於執行如 OSINT 情資(Collector)、超前預測(Predictor)和網頁自動化(Browser)等任務。
  • 深度防禦: 具備 16 個離散的安全系統,包括 WASM 雙計費沙盒、Merkle hash-chain 稽核軌跡和提示詞注入掃描。
  • 廣泛的連接性: 支援 40 個管道適配器(Telegram, Discord, WhatsApp, 等)和 27 個 LLM 提供者。
  • 高效率: 與基於 Python 的框架相比,極低的冷啟動時間(<200ms)和極小的記憶體佔用(閒置時 40MB)。
  • 原生桌面應用程式: 包括一個用於系統匣和通知管理的 Tauri 2.0 原生應用程式。

Sources